    Allu Arjun's Duvvada Jagannadham teaser crosses 6 million mark

    Telugu actor Allu Arjun is on a roll. The first teaser of his new film, DJ Duvvada Jagannadham which was unveiled on February 23 has already crossed 6 million views on YouTube.

    The 47-second clip of the romantic comedy, which also stars model-turned-actor Pooja Hegde, has Arjun dominating the frames with his superlative comic timing. The film is directed by Harish Shankar.

    The teaser opens with a dhoti-clad Arjun, deep in a puja ritual, complete with his rudraksh, vibhuti, aarti, et al. The next shot shows a happy guy riding a scooter laden with vegetables on a busy street. We are introduced to his lady love (Pooja Hegde) soon, but the romance is cut short when Arjun is shown threatening someone over the phone.

    Arjun has had a superb run at the box office with his last two films, Sarrainodu (2016) and S/O Satyamurthy (2015), turning out to be huge hits.




    It may be recalled here that the teaser, along with that of another popular Telugu actor and Arjun’s uncle, Pawan Kalyan’s Katamarayudu, has been in news for totally unexpected reasons: For the number of ‘dislikes’ they have garnered.

    As on Wednesday morning, Duvvada Jagannadham had been disliked 110,670 times while the figure for the Pawan Kalyan’s film stood at 28,086.




    The reason for this trend is that the fans of the two stars have always been at loggerheads with each other, particularly after Arjun reportedly refused a request by Pawan’s fans at an event last year. Arjun has been the target of attacks by the fans of his uncle for really no fault of his.

    At an awards function in 2016, fans of the actor-politician had requested Arjun to chant ‘Power Star’ (sobriquet his fans use for Pawan) which Arjun refused saying “Cheppanu brother (I won’t say it)”, reports Times of India.
